Administration Annual Report <br />City Manager Yunker presented the Annual Report for Administration, including information on <br />the 2025 Strategic Plan, 2025 meetings, members of staff, and the responsibilities of the <br />administration department. <br />Assistant City Manager Morello reviewed the goals and accomplishments from 2025 related to <br />the City Code and planning, communications and engagement, human resources, sustainability <br />programs, and plans. <br />Mr. Yunker provided information on community affiliations, grants, and cooperative ventures. <br />He highlighted information on looking ahead in 2026 and reviewed ways to connect and engage. <br />Councilmember Doolan recognized the great year and appreciated the progress that was made in <br />sustainability. <br />Councilmember Jenson thanked staff for choosing to work in St. Anthony, recognizing the wide <br />variety of work that is accomplished by staff. <br />Councilmember Elnagdy expressed appreciation to staff. <br />Mayor Webster commented that the staff team is small and appreciated the collaboration that <br />occurs between staff. She noted that the tone and culture that is modeled by staff is seen <br />throughout the departments. <br />B.
